Output 3de3f6e179e2e033f62f05bd5039b28ed1e56a4d1df0dbbab4089b678899f117:1

value
664867
script pubkey
OP_0 OP_PUSHBYTES_20 107c0efd0b31146cd85b344a14546cd614ee20c8
address
bc1qzp7qalgtxy2xekzmx39pg4rv6c2wugxg9u9kt5
transaction
3de3f6e179e2e033f62f05bd5039b28ed1e56a4d1df0dbbab4089b678899f117
spent
true